P. Lattaioli is a scholar working on Animal Science and Zoology, Reproductive Medicine and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, P. Lattaioli has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 291 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Animal Science and Zoology, 9 papers in Reproductive Medicine and 4 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in P. Lattaioli’s work include Rabbits: Nutrition, Reproduction, Health (11 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(9 papers) and Reproductive Biology and Fertility (3 papers). P. Lattaioli is often cited by papers focused on Rabbits: Nutrition, Reproduction, Health (11 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(9 papers) and Reproductive Biology and Fertility (3 papers). P. Lattaioli coll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Brazil and France. P. Lattaioli's co-authors include Cesare Castellini, Alessandro Dal Bosco, Alba Minelli, Cecilia Mugnai, Daniela Beghelli, M. Bernardini, Michèle Theau-Clément, F. Pizzi, R. Cardinali and Lavinia Liguori and has published in prestigious journals such as Andrology, Theriogenology and Journal of Experimental Zoology.
